﻿

.contentboxtop { background-color: #0054a3; width: 100%; padding: 65px 0px 55px 0px; }
    .contentboxtop .cntitle { font-size: 36px; color: #fff;text-shadow: 0px 1px 3px rgba(34,23,20,0.4) }
        .contentboxtop .cntitle b { font-size: 36px; font-weight: 400; color: #fff; margin-left: 10px; }

.contentbox { max-width: 1200px; width: 100%; }
    .contentbox .conn { width: 100%; margin: 20px 0px; text-align: left; }


        .contentbox .conn .newslist { margin-top: 15px; margin-bottom: 45px; width: 100%; }
            .contentbox .conn .newslist ul { overflow: hidden; width: 100%; font-size: 0px; text-align: left; }
                .contentbox .conn .newslist ul li { font-size: 0px; background-color: #fff; display: inline-block; vertical-align: top; width: 100%; padding: 35px 0px; border-bottom: solid 1px #f7f6f6; }
                    .contentbox .conn .newslist ul li .ll { vertical-align: top; display: inline-block; width: 36%; }
                        .contentbox .conn .newslist ul li .ll .picbox { position: relative; }
                            .contentbox .conn .newslist ul li .ll .picbox img { border-radius: 8px; width: 100%; }

                    .contentbox .conn .newslist ul li .rr { vertical-align: top; display: inline-block; width: 64%; padding-left: 20px; }
                        .contentbox .conn .newslist ul li .rr .title { width: 100%; }
                            .contentbox .conn .newslist ul li .rr .title b { display: block; font-weight: 400; font-size: 14px; color: #b5b5b5; padding: 10px 0px; }
                            .contentbox .conn .newslist ul li .rr .title a { display: block; font-size: 20px; color: #000; padding: 10px 0px; font-weight: bold; }
                        .contentbox .conn .newslist ul li .rr .text { margin-top: 20px; line-height: 1.8; font-size: 14px; color: #948f8f }





.pages { width: 100%; text-align: center; margin-top: 20px; margin-bottom: 20px; }
    .pages .nodate { padding: 6px 5px 5px 5px; margin-bottom: 15px; text-align: center; clear: both; font-size: 12px; }
    .pages a.PageLink { font-size: 18px; display: inline-block; height: 34px; line-height: 34px; margin-left: 10px; border-radius: 17px; padding: 0px 12px; color: #333; overflow: hidden; text-decoration: none; background-color: #fff; border: 1px solid #eeeeee; }
    .pages .PageSel { font-size: 18px; display: inline-block; height: 34px; line-height: 34px; margin-left: 10px; border-radius: 17px; padding: 0px 12px; color: #fff; overflow: hidden; text-decoration: none; background-color: #000; }


.content { width: 98%; max-width: 1210px; margin-top: 45px; margin-bottom: 45px; }
    .content .title { font-size: 26px; margin-top: 30px; margin-bottom: 30px; color: #000; }
    .content .infos { text-align: left; line-height: 22px; font-size: 14px; margin-bottom: 60px; }




@media only screen and (max-width:960px) {
    .contentbox .conn .right { padding-left: 20px; }
}


@media only screen and (max-width:768px) {
    .contentboxtop .cntitle { font-size: 22px; }
        .contentboxtop .cntitle b { font-size: 16px; }
    .contentbox .conn { padding: 0px 10px; }
    .newslist { margin-top: 20px; margin-bottom: 20px; }
        .newslist ul li .rr .title b { font-size: 12px; padding: 5px 0px; }
        .newslist ul li .rr .title a { font-size: 14px; padding: 5px 0px; }

    #textinfo { display: none; }
}
